Here, we provide comprehensive information. . Taiwan Cement has just commissioned a 107MWh energy storage project at its Yingde plant in Guangdong province, China. Subsidiary NHOA Energy worked on the installation and has been promoting it this week. The battery storage works in conjunction with a 42MW waste heat recovery (WHR) unit, a 8MWp. . With true hard-off and cool storage, many packs lose roughly 1–3% capacity per month from chemistry alone. If electronics remain awake, losses can rise to tens of percent. Measure your drain and plan checks every 2–3 months. Should panels stay connected during storage? No.. The Kaleta Hydropower Station, located on the Konkoure River in Guinea's Fouta Djallon highlands, has become a symbol of progress, featured on the country's 20,000-franc banknote. Built by China International Water and Electric Corporation (CWE), a subsidiary of China Communications Construction.
